NEI
Northern Engineering Industries Ltd., with headquarters and five of its twelve UK
trading companies on Tyneside, operates worldwide in mechanical, electrical, combustion and structural engineering.
Its turnover exceeds £700 million and it exports at a rate of more than £200 million
per year.
The
NEI employs over 29,000 people in the United Kingdom and over 7,000 overseas. group's principal sectors of activity are power generation, industrial power and process plant, electrical plant and controls and mechanical handling plant, and interests in advanced light electronics are developing with the acquisition of organisations overseas, principally in North America (Ferranti-Packard, Extel Corporation, International Power Machines).
